It's a Mad, Mad, Mad World II Trivia
It's a Mad, Mad, Mad World II was released on February 13, 1988.
It's a Mad, Mad, Mad World II was directed by Clifton Ko Chi-Sum.
It's a Mad, Mad, Mad World II has a runtime of 1h 36m.
It's a Mad, Mad, Mad World II was produced by Linda Kuk Mei-Lai.
After losing their lottery winnings during the bank's closure, the Biu family's luck changes again as Bill's job promotion and daughters' education and work careers sent them and the entire family to lead their new lives in Canada, where new misadventures await.
The key characters in It's a Mad, Mad, Mad World II are Uncle Bill (Bill Tung Biu), Aunt Lydia (Lydia Shum Tin-Ha), Mao Mao (Lowell Lo Koon-Ting).
It's a Mad, Mad, Mad World II is a Comedy film.
